feat: add VB.NET (.vb) language support via tree-sitter

This commit adds full VB.NET language support to graphify, raising the
supported language count from 25 to 26. The implementation follows the
established LanguageConfig pattern used by all other tree-sitter-backed
extractors.

New dependency:
- Adds optional extra [vbnet] backed by tree-sitter-vbnet (published
  to PyPI at https://pypi.org/project/tree-sitter-vbnet/0.1.0/).
  Install with: pip install graphifyy[vbnet]

graphify/detect.py:
- Added .vb to CODE_EXTENSIONS so VB.NET files are discovered during
  corpus ingestion and file-system watching.

graphify/extract.py:
- _import_vbnet(): import handler for imports_statement nodes; emits
  imports edges using the namespace_name child text.
- _vbnet_extra_walk(): extra-walk hook that intercepts namespace_block
  nodes, emits a namespace node, and recurses.
- _VBNET_CONFIG: full LanguageConfig covering class_block / module_block /
  structure_block / interface_block as class types; method_declaration /
  constructor_declaration / property_declaration as function types;
  invocation call nodes with target/member_access fields.
- VB.NET-specific branches in _extract_generic:
  * Class body: VB.NET has no wrapper body node; inherits and implements
    are named fields directly on the class_block. Emits separate inherits
    and implements edges for each base type, stripping generic arguments.
  * Constructor name: constructor_declaration carries no name field in
    the grammar; always resolves to New.
  * Function body: uses the declaration node itself as body sentinel so
    the call-graph pass can find invocations inside methods.
- extract_vbnet(path): public wrapper that delegates to _extract_generic.
- _DISPATCH['.vb']: routes .vb files to extract_vbnet.

pyproject.toml:
- Added vbnet = ['tree-sitter-vbnet'] optional dependency group.
- Added 'tree-sitter-vbnet' to the all extra.

tests/fixtures/sample.vb:
- New fixture file exercising: Imports statements, Namespace block,
  Interface, Class with Inherits + Implements, Module, Structure,
  Sub/Function/Property methods, and method calls.

tests/test_languages.py:
- Added 13 tests covering: no-error, class/interface/module/structure
  detection, method detection, imports relation, inherits edge,
  implements edge, and no-dangling-edges invariant.

README.md:
- Updated language count 25 to 26.
- Added VB.NET to language list and file-extension table.

def _vbnet_extra_walk(node, source: bytes, file_nid: str, stem: str, str_path: str,
nodes: list, edges: list, seen_ids: set, function_bodies: list,
parent_class_nid: str | None, add_node_fn, add_edge_fn,
walk_fn) -> bool:
"""Handle namespace_block for VB.NET. Returns True if handled."""
if node.type == "namespace_block":
name_node = node.child_by_field_name("name")
if name_node:
ns_name = _read_text(name_node, source)
ns_nid = _make_id(stem, ns_name)
line = node.start_point[0] + 1
add_node_fn(ns_nid, ns_name, line)
add_edge_fn(file_nid, ns_nid, "contains", line)
for child in node.children:
walk_fn(child, parent_class_nid)
return True
return False

_VBNET_CONFIG = LanguageConfig(
ts_module="tree_sitter_vbnet",
ts_language_fn="language",
class_types=frozenset({"class_block", "module_block", "structure_block", "interface_block"}),
function_types=frozenset({"method_declaration", "constructor_declaration", "property_declaration"}),
import_types=frozenset({"imports_statement"}),
call_types=frozenset({"invocation"}),
call_function_field="target",
call_accessor_node_types=frozenset({"member_access"}),
call_accessor_field="member",
function_boundary_types=frozenset({"method_declaration", "constructor_declaration", "property_declaration"}),
import_handler=_import_vbnet,
)

Imports System
Imports System.Collections.Generic
Imports System.Net.Http
Namespace GraphifyDemo
Public Interface IProcessor
Function Process(items As List(Of String)) As List(Of String)
End Interface
Public Class DataProcessor
Inherits BaseProcessor
Implements IProcessor
Private ReadOnly _client As HttpClient
Public Sub New()
_client = New HttpClient()
End Sub
Public Function Process(items As List(Of String)) As List(Of String)
Return Validate(items)
End Function
Private Function Validate(items As List(Of String)) As List(Of String)
Dim result As New List(Of String)
For Each item In items
If Not String.IsNullOrEmpty(item) Then
result.Add(item.Trim())
End If
Next
Return result
End Function
End Class
Public Module AppHelper
Public Sub Run(processor As IProcessor)
Dim data As New List(Of String)
data.Add("hello")
processor.Process(data)
End Sub
End Module
Public Structure Point
Implements IComparable
Public X As Double
Public Y As Double
Public Function CompareTo(obj As Object) As Integer
Return 0
End Function
End Structure
End Namespace
